question solve for x and graph the solution on the number line below. ( \frac{x}{-4} > -2 )
Step1: Multiply both sides by -4
When multiplying both sides of an inequality by a negative number, the inequality sign flips. So we have:
$\frac{x}{-4} \times (-4) < -2 \times (-4)$
Step2: Simplify both sides
Simplifying the left side gives $x$, and simplifying the right side gives $8$. So we get:
$x < 8$
